Converting mass measurement units across international scaling standards involves executing precise numeric coefficient multipliers. While mass measures the amount of actual matter inside an object, weight is the gravitational force acting upon that mass.
In science and global commerce, our base benchmark scales are anchored securely against the standard SI metric unit: the Gram (g). Running precise mathematical algorithms avoids calculation bugs or discrepancies in inventory sheets, lab data, and construction blueprints.
| Weight Unit | Abbreviation | Value in Grams (g) | Measurement System |
|---|---|---|---|
| Kilogram | kg | 1,000 g | Metric |
| Pound | lb | 453.59237 g | Imperial |
| Ounce | oz | 28.349523125 g | Imperial |
| Stone | st | 6,350.29318 g | Imperial |

Mass is a fundamental physical property representing the amount of matter in an object, remaining identical anywhere in the universe. Weight is the actual force exerted by gravity on that mass. For instance, you would have the same mass on the Moon as on Earth, but you would weigh roughly 16.5% of your earth weight due to lower lunar gravity forces.
To convert kilograms to pounds manually, multiply the mass by 2.20462. For example, if you have 5 kilograms, multiplying 5 by 2.20462 yields approximately 11.023 pounds. Use our dynamic tools above to convert numbers seamlessly with high decimal precision.
